# Schema registry constants for the Fennelwick event bus.
# Every producer must register its event schema before publishing;
# unregistered payloads are rejected at the gateway. The registry
# caches compiled validators in-process, so restarts trigger a brief
# warm-up spike against the registry service. If you see validation
# latency alerts, check cache hit rates before scaling. The retry
# and TTL behavior is governed by the constants below.

tuning constants:
QUOTAS = {
    "druwyn": 5,
    "holix": 5,
    "zorath": 5,
    "holwyn": 10,
}

## Authentication

The Cartwheel load-testing harness drives synthetic traffic against the staging checkout flow, and every simulated purchase must authenticate against the internal order service. Note that this credential is distinct from the one used by the live storefront; mixing them up will cause test orders to land in production queues, which generates real alerts for the on-call team. Configure the harness with the service key below.

API key for tajog-bajof: kto15_6fvgvYZbOKdLifh

Subject: DR drill — Bouncemill processor failover

As planned, Thursday's disaster-recovery drill will fail over the Bouncemill email bounce processor to the Fenwick standby cluster. Expect a ten-minute pause in suppression-list updates; queued bounces replay automatically afterward. To unseal the standby's credential store during the drill, use the recovery passphrase provided below.

unlock words, hahip-baduf: holwyn-istath-julvan

## Prefetcher sketch

Tilebird guesses which map tiles you'll pan to next and warms them in the background. The heuristic is dumb on purpose: extrapolate velocity, fetch a cone of tiles ahead. Works surprisingly well. The cone width and fetch budget are the knobs that matter, shown below.

constants for bagag-fawip:
BUDGETS = {
    "wenius": 400,
    "brieth": 224,
    "rusath": 783,
    "eliys": 187,
    "aldax": 737,
    "ralion": 818,
    "istius": 153,
}